Specifications include, but are not limited to: Required Services 1. Review of City business licenses to ensure that all persons/companies doing business with the City have a current business license. Review may include physical inventory of businesses and/or analyses of State databases such as State Board of Equalization or Franchise Tax Board. a. This review may include assisting the City in determining those persons/businesses that fall in the category of “Residential Landlord” as defined in business license ballot Measure O approved by the voters on November 4, 2014 and effective December 9, 2014 (see Exhibit A). If there is an additional cost associated with this particular service, please detail in the sealed Cost Proposal. 2. For any business that does not have a current business license, achieve licensing compliance from those businesses. a. This may include assisting in achieving licensing compliance from those persons/businesses that fall in the category of “Residential Landlord” (see 1a. above). If there is an additional cost associated with this particular service, please detail in the sealed Cost Proposal. 3. Provide assistance to City in verifying accuracy of “gross receipts” reported by businesses as basis of business license tax amount due
